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0763151 0427833 494065164 40955923068 3935
038965 81147523615
038965 81147523615
03613 56903585 943519330
All about undefined
Interested in learning more?
038965 81147523615
03613 56903585 943519330
See more
140558 768322
039 76121960626 070 27
See more
8736379365 83
54429243382 4391 82816289751 26 39
See more